Overview
A Kubota BX23S owner documents how a cracked three-point lift arm went unnoticed until it interfered with PTO engagement, then walks through the full replacement himself. He covers diagnosing the symptom, sourcing the part at his dealer, the spline-shaft removal trick, applying anti-seize, snap-ring reinstallation, and linkage adjustment, plus why aggressive mowing on rough terrain likely caused the failure. Most useful for BX23S owners facing the same crack.

Kubota BX23S
- PTO horsepower
- 17.7 hp
- Loader lift capacity
- 6258 N (1407 lbs) [LA340] / 5719 N (1286 lbs) [LA340S]
- 3-point lift capacity
- 1,213 lbs.
- Hydraulic flow
- 6.2 gpm (23.5 l/min.)
